## Secure Interview Room (Room 3C, Harrow Wing)

Team assistants at Claverly Group book Room 3C for candidate interviews involving confidential materials. Reserve it at least one day ahead via the room planner, and confirm the panel list with the hiring lead. The room locks automatically; do not wedge the door. Interviewers must be escorted in and out by an assistant. To unlock the keypad for your booking, enter the code shown below.

staff pass of kawip-hawef = bdg-QLP-2

Ticket OPS-locked-vault: Hi team, quick one for the newcomers. The Fernbay vault that stores sampling rules for Blatherbox (our famously chatty service) locked up after too many bad login attempts overnight. Until it's open, logs are flowing unsampled and the bill is climbing. Anyone on rotation can unlock it — just use the recovery passphrase shown right below.

vault phrase of kawep-tahog = ulaix-briath

// Heads-up for the security review: this constant caps how far back the
// Drossel retention sweeper will reach on any single pass. We keep it at
// 35 days so one misconfigured tenant can't trigger a mass purge of the
// whole Lanternware archive in one go. Changing it requires sign-off from
// the data-governance crew — sweeps are irreversible, no tombstones kept.
// If you need the exact artifact we validated this against, the build
// token is recorded on the line just below.

pipeline stamp: htk9_ce63042d9